Zero Dark Thirty – This implies a generally unpleasant hour of … the closest verizon storeWebIn the Navy, gear adrift is any gear that hasn't been properly put away. A common phrase is "Gear adrift is a gift," meaning that you leave your stuff up for grabs if you neglect to store it properly.
